Which is why it matters whether it is actually a fever. If OP had posted a number, I wouldn't have asked. I've worked in a pediatrician's office. I swear to bejesus, this was an actual comment from a mom: "Well, Sally usually runs really low, so 100 is really high for her." [more questions] "Yes, I added a degree because I took it in her armpit." It's like pulling teeth to sort out what's going on. It's not technically a fever until it's a core temp of 100.4, but people make all sorts of interpretations on their own. Really, they do. You would not believe. |
